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
497417003 9115 0484434 95141785
795264 794
795264 794
36915176 5682 9366 609083557 378
All about undefined
Interested in learning more?
795264 794
36915176 5682 9366 609083557 378
See more
7871 56 789284
37 85 466 8264 8916419
See more
6608108367 03176324650 661783373
57667 290 295 342416 4602070
See more